Photo: Petrol Records/ Eagle Rock Films INXS Live Baby Live Wembley Stadium ?soundtrack is set for release on 15 November. The full live show will be released for the first time internationally across 3LP Deluxe, 2CD & all digital formats. The landmark performance featuring hits ‘Need You Tonight‘, ‘New Sensation‘, ‘Devil Inside‘, a previously thought ‘lost track ‘Lately from the album X and many more have been newly remixed by Giles Martin & Sam Okell at Abbey Road Studios. The vinyl & CD formats feature unseen imagery from the show, new essays from the band and sleeve notes by broadcaster and uber INXS fan Jamie East, who was in the crowd that day. On Saturday 13 July 1991 INXS delivered the gig of their lives at Londons Wembley Stadium to 74, 000 ecstatic fans. After a decade and a half on the road the group was at the peak of their live powers and the performance that day shows they were now indeed a world-class stadium band. As uDiscover Music previously reported, the film of Live Baby Live will also be in cinemas for the very first time. This masterclass in showmanship and musicianship has been painstakingly restored over a twelve-month period from the original 35mm negative to Ultra HD 4K. Now presented in cinematic 16:9 widescreen for this first ever Theatrical exhibition, the original film was presented in 4:3 aspect ratio, but the restored version was created by shot-by-shot repositioning to get the best out of the frame. To accompany the astonishing visual upgrade, the audio is now be presented in full Dolby Atmos, created by Giles Martin, the bands Executive Music Director, and Sam Okell at Abbey Road Studios. Six years to the day of Live Aid and five years and a day since the band supported Queen at Wembley Stadium, INXS headlined their own show at the famed venue to a sell-out crowd of 73, 791 crazed fans. The event, called ‘Summer XS, was immortalized in the concert film ‘Live Baby Live, directed by David Mallet. Twenty-eight years on, the film has been painstakingly restored from the original 35mm negative. The film is now presented in glorious cinematic widescreen, created by going through the film shot by shot and repositioning every single one to get the best out of the frame. This exclusive event will feature a special “lost” performance discovered during the restoration ? ‘Lately from the ‘X album, now returned to its rightful position in the concert setlist.

For those around during the heyday of Australias INXS, attending the Summer XS Tour was nothing less than epic. As far as the Wembley Stadium concert, it would spawn the bands first ever live album, Live Baby Live which was released in November of the same year. The video footage of the event was then re-released as a DVD in 2003 ? digitally remixed and mastered in 5. 1 surround sound. Which leads us to present day where the film has been restored from the original 35mm negative where it was gone through?shot by shot, repositioning every single one to get the best out of the frame. The newly restored edition made a world premiere at the Byron Bay International Film Festival in late October 2019. Prior to this, special screenings in July had also taken place, including one held in New York city, before it was released in Australia and New Zealand on November 14th via Fathom Events and in Europe areas such U. K., Ireland, Greece, and the Netherlands by Cinevents. Which leads us to the most recent theatrical release on December 9th in theaters across the USA.? As far as the film itself, it starts off in a sea of eager onlookers, as INXS gives their all without hesitation for this Wembley Stadium performance. For this remastered addition they also uncovered the tune “Lately” from 1990s X album in the setlist ? a track which somehow had been edited out previously. Wonderful to watch, as Michael Hutchence breezed through the upbeat tracks wearing his half black on white star, and half black on white striped fitted pants, his bandmates pulled off the rest of the magic; the core group consisted of Tim Farriss (lead guitar) Kirk Pengilly (rhythm guitar/saxophone) Garry Gary Beers (bass guitar) Andrew Farriss (keyboards) and Jon Farriss (drums. ? With the band feeding off the positive energy of almost 74, 000 people, the only proper way to end an already over the top encore was with “Devil Inside. ” After this glorious moment Hutchence grabs an available guitar and storms over to the amplifier to create some end of show noise feedback of his own accord ? stepping out of his comfort zone and connected on an even deeper level with the audience. Naturally a concert of this magnitude from INXS also featured classics such “Mystify Me, ” “Suicide Blonde, ” “New Sensation, ” and there was nothing but pure joy felt by the crowd in attendance. Live at Wembley Stadium 1991 Live album by INXS Released 7?February?2014 Recorded 13 July 1991 Venue Wembley Stadium Genre Rock Label Petrol Electric INXS live chronology The Very Best (2011) Live at Wembley Stadium 1991 (2014) Mystify: A Musical Journey with Michael Hutchence (2019) Live at Wembley Stadium 1991" is a live album recorded by Australian band INXS. Background and release [ edit] On 13 July 1991, INXS were filmed in concert at Wembley Stadium in London, performing to a sold-out mass of 72, 000 fans. This concert was filmed in 35?mm and directed by David Malle with no less than 17 cameras. [1] The album was released in February 2014 to coincide with the screening of INXS: Never Tear Us Apart, an Australian miniseries about INXS that commenced airing on 9 February 2014 and concluded the following week on 16 February on the Seven Network. [2] Track listing [ edit] The album was released as a digital download on 7 February 2014. Available now from Live Baby Live ‘The Stairs is often cited by INXS fans as the best single the band never released and named by Sir Elton John as his favourite ever INXS song. The Stairs was only ever issued as a limited edition live single in Holland making it one of the most highly prized items in the INXS canon. Its truly one of the bands ‘lost classics. This new digital single of ‘The Stairs was recorded on Saturday 13th July 1991, when INXS, one of the worlds most revered and iconic bands, delivered the gig of their lives at Londons Wembley Stadium to 74, 000 ecstatic fans. After a decade and a half on the road the group was at the peak of their live powers and the performance that day shows they were now indeed a world-class stadium band. INXSs Kirk Pengilly says of the song: “The Stairs was one of our favourites to perform live. ? It starts simply giving us a breather on stage and then builds & builds right to the end. ? I think this (LBL) version is more powerful than the studio recording.? Definitely one of Michaels finest, “social comment” lyrics. At the time Michael Hutchence described ‘The Stairs as “The most ambitious song Ive ever written. ” Guitarist Tim Farriss remembers that it was “Probably?one of my favourite songs we ever recorded and a stand out track of Live Baby Live. ?Pretty much sums up the ever changing passages of the lives we all lead and how they all intertwine. ” Andrew Farriss who co-wrote the song with Hutchence spoke about the track in 1990 saying “It deals with people in highly urbanised environments not communicating”. Almost thirty years later the song has lost none of its power and is as relevant today as it was then. The original Live Baby Live album went Top 10 in Australia and the UK following its release in 1991, going on to Platinum status in the US and Australia. The original Live Baby Live release was a 16-track companion with tracks recorded around the world on the X-Factor Tour.
